Age Relaxation Rules for the Initial appointment to Civil Posts has been mentioned here with detail. These rules are according to the 1993 relaxation of Upper Age Limit Rules Vide Islamabad, the 4th November, 1993. S.R.O. 1079(I)/93. These Rules will not be applicable for the appointment to the posts in BPS-17 to be filled through C.S.S. Competitive Examination. In pursuance of rule 12 of the Civil Servants (Appointment, Promotion and Transfer) Rules, 1973, the President is pleased to make the following rules, namely:- Maximum age limit relaxation is as under:-
(i) (a). Candidates belonging to Scheduled Castes, Buddhist Community, recognized tribes of the Tribal Areas, Azad Kashmir and Northern Areas for all posts under the Federal Government of Pakistan 3 years.
(b) Candidates belonging to Sindh (Rural) and Baluchistan for posts in BPS-15 and below under the Federal Government of Pakistan 3 years.
(ii) Released or Retired Officers / personnel of Pakistan Armed Forces 15 years or the number of years actually served in the Armed Forces of Pakistan, whichever is less will be applicable.
(iii) Government servants who have completed two years continuous government service on the closing date for receipt of applications. 10 years, up to the age of 55 years.
(iv) Disabled persons for appointment to posts in BPS-15 and below. 10 years
(v) Widows, son or daughter of a deceased civil servant who dies during service. 5 years.
No special relaxation is available for FPSC employee.
